DPR Evaluation: Proposal development

The Department of Petroleum Resources is currently under pressure as a result of falling oil and gas reserves following the threat of the development to the country’s economy. The agency has developed short and medium-term strategies to increase the reserves. Also, there are long-term strategies targeted at sustaining the reserves. Our correspondent gathered that the DPR planned to undertake more seismic data coverage for better regional and basinal studies and drilling of exploration wells in the short to medium term. It is also working towards active exploration drilling and drilling for deeper plays in the short to medium term. To sustain the reserves, it hopes to implement enhanced recovery methods for the short, medium and long terms; and also achieve unitisation of non-straddled reservoirs in the short to medium run.
